Housing disrepair refers to issues within a rental property that affect the safety, health, and comfort of tenants. Common problems include dampness, mold, structural damage, and inadequate heating or plumbing. If your living conditions are compromised due to the landlord’s failure to maintain the property, you may have the right to file a claim for repairs and compensation. Understanding your rights is the first step in ensuring a safe and habitable living environment.
